Once again, 'Oursong' has made headlines for securing $7.5 million in seed funding, underscoring its growing influence.

NFTs John Legend recognized the impact of NFTs as a transformative resource for artists, prompting him to introduce 'OurSong,' designed to help creators convert their artistic endeavors into collectible NFT trading cards dubbed 'Vibes.'

Our Happy Company, the creator behind the 'OurSong' platform, proudly announced that it raised $7.5 million in funding, driven by Web3 leaders like Animoca Brands and Ventures Crypto. This investment will facilitate global growth and introduce new functionalities. OurSong app.

Animoca Brands is focused on aiding enterprises that are crafting an open metaverse and views 'OurSong' as a platform that empowers creators, enabling them to achieve unprecedented success.

John Legend's OurSong app

Co-founded by the renowned musician and producer, 'OurSong' has been designed to help entertainers earn revenue without entangling themselves in the complexities of digital assets. The platform not only allows artists to commercialize their work but also fosters community-building. Additionally, it's accessible as a mobile application that simplifies NFT transactions, allowing purchases via credit cards, while also offering options for transferring NFTs to MetaMask or other crypto wallets.

Notable collaborators on the 'OurSong' project include Kevin Lin, co-founder of Twitch, and Chris Lin, CEO of music streaming service Kkbox.

Chris Lin, co-founder and CEO of Our Happy Company, stated, 'Our focus is on making NFTs accessible to everyone. This funding round highlights the validation of our strategy and reflects our accomplishments in a remarkably short period. Since OurSong's launch earlier this year, we have witnessed a rapid growth in our community as creators utilize this innovative technology to connect with their fans in exciting new ways.' said Metaverse Fundraising Weekly Report #5
